Torino Film Festival

Next Monday, 27th November 2017, on the occasion of the 35th edition of the Torino Film Festival it will be presented a preview of Elisabetta Sgarbi’s documentary film L’altrove più vicino: Un viaggio in Slovenia in the auditorium of Intesa Sanpaolo’s skyscraper at 7:00 pm.

The documentary film tells the story of Maestro Igor Coretti Kuret, founder of the European Spirit of Youth Orchestra which gathers talented young people coming from different European countries.

The showing of the film will be introduced by its director and will see the participation of Claudio Magris along with Paolo Rumiz who, during the last two years, has been the narrator of the group.

Later, a musical moment curated by seven musicians of the orchestra.

Free entrance subject to prior booking on the website of Torino Film Festival starting from Tuesday 21rst November at 10:00 am.
